Output 2946aaf3001a9b766c1f651868526a130e5d9b1cee3376db4f1da40737868dee:1

value
3893644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b0cfbd72ca196d62fabe218457da604b5474389 OP_EQUAL
address
38XrA4KB3SP7TU5p5qYD5hkLuHjazXj5LR
transaction
2946aaf3001a9b766c1f651868526a130e5d9b1cee3376db4f1da40737868dee
spent
true